Local Revenue Support: Application Access and Assistance
Overview:
All County and District staff must request and accept an invitation to access the Local Revenue application.
The request for an invitation should include your full name and email as well as the section of the application (Property Tax or Enrollment Fee) that you require access to.
What You Need to Do:
- Send a request to SCFF@cccco.edu including the information specified above.
- Once you receive the invitation via email, follow the instructions to accept it.
- Sign in and ensure that you have the appropriate access before proceeding.
Overview:
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A) is required for enhanced security during the sign-in process. Users must set up MFA after accepting their invitation to access the Local Revenue application.
Recommended MFA Applications:
- Microsoft Authenticator Mobile App
- Google Authenticator Mobile App
- Authenticator.cc Browser Extension(Chrome, Edge, and Firefox)
Steps to Set Up MFA:
- Follow the instructions provided in the invitation email to configure MFA on your device.
- You may use any of the recommended MFA applications or another supported by your organization.

Overview:
If you have already configured MFA for Local Revenue and you change or lose your phone, you will need to reset or transfer your MFA setup before logging in to Local Revenue again.
Steps:
- Contact the Help Desk at support@cccco.edu to request an MFA reset.
- Provide your full name and work email address for verification.
- After the reset is confirmed, sign in again to Local Revenue.
- Follow the steps in the “Setting Up MFA” section to configure MFA on your new device.
Important Notes:
- MFA cannot be transferred automatically between devices.
- You must re-enroll your new device once the reset is complete.
